Illinois Panel Affirms Judgment For Insurer, Dismisses Appeal Of Bad Faith Claim

(December 1, 2017, 9:23 AM EST) -- CHICAGO — The First District Illinois Appellate Court, Sixth Division, on Nov. 17 affirmed a trial court’s ruling in favor of an insurer on a breach of contract claim but dismissed the insured’s appeal as it pertained to the trial court’s ruling on the bad faith claim because the insured failed to cite any legal authority in her brief regarding the bad faith claim (Carolyn Anderson v. Allstate Indemnity Co., No. 1-16-2043, Ill. App., 1st Dist., 6th Div., 2017 Ill. App. Unpub. LEXIS 2357)....
